My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Meet Florence! This sweetheart is searching for a home where she can feel safe and loved - and once you have earned her trust, Flo will be your absolute best friend! Flo is currently residing in a volunteer foster home through Animal Advocates. Flo's fosters describe her as, "a playful, sweet cat who just wants to be loved.  She maybe a little shy at first, but quickly opens up and when she does, Flo will be obsessed with you!" Flo will now seek out her fosters for snuggling and purrs almost instantly.  She loves chasing after wand and laser pointer toys.   

Flo has very distinct unusual orange, tan, grey "leopard" print fur.  Her birthday is approximated in June 2023. She has tested negative for Felv/FIV, up-to-date on vaccinations, treated for fleas/dewormed as well as spayed and microchipped. She lives with other cats at her foster home, but has "mixed" reviews and is more indifferent towards to the other cats (not aggressive at all). Flo will do best in a home with caregivers who are willing to take slow, measured steps to help her feel comfortable in a new environment and with any resident felines.   Flo really is in tune with people - comfortable and loving.

Additional adoption info

Adoption Guidelines:
- Before scheduling a meet-and-greet with one of our adoptable cats or dogs, you must complete an application and interview with an adoption team member.
- You must be 21 years or older.
- All animals in your home must be up-to-date on vaccinations and spayed / neutered.
- If you rent, we will need a copy of your lease stating the landlord permits pets along with the landlord’s contact information.
- We do not place animals as gifts for others.
- Adopted animals must be kept as indoor companions.
- We reserve the right to perform a home visit.

We aim to provide high quality care for the well-being of rescued cats and dogs until they are placed in forever homes. All animals are regularly vet checked, fully vaccinated, spayed / neutered and microchipped. They are routinely treated for fleas and worms as well as any medical issues.

Except for a limited number of cats fostered at our headquarters, our adoptable animals are cared for in loving volunteer foster homes. We get to know the pets’ personalities and needs very well, striving to make the best possible match for both animals and adopters.

More about this rescue

Animal Advocates is a nonprofit 501(c)(3), all volunteer, animal welfare organization involved in the rescue, care and placement of companion animals. Serving the Pittsburgh area since 1984, Animal Advocates has adhered to a no-kill policy and engaged in community-based advocacy on behalf of animals since its inception.

We believe the relationship between a human and companion animal is an important bond that improves the physical and social well-being of individuals and the community at large.
